Iwork for a very large company up in north wales and we have recently started a bug ( bicycle users group) in work too address some issues.... so just wondering what equipment other people have at their workplaces... been looking at the viability of having showers/changing/drying rooms in purpose fitted portacabins so no factory space is then needed for these.. plus they can then be located right next too the bike sheds... does anyone have anything like this at their workplace??

We have great facilties.
8 showers (4 men, 4 women)
Towels provided and cleaned everyday
Watered down shampoo provided if you like that as well.
Space for changing.
Space for shoes
Space for hanging clothes with hangers provided.
*rant start* Space on the floor for a c*** to leave his dirty underwear (he then puts it on in the afternoon) *rant over*
Lockers and a separate clothes rack for suits.

We have no racks for bikes or showers etc .... so we all smell at work and stuff drips on the hangers. The front of the building on a good cycling day looks terrible with about 10 bikes piled in a corner !

So .... I have to ride to my parents who happen to live 4 mins away and have a quick wash and lock the bike in their garage. There is no interest at work to do anything for cyclists as we are the minority. Only three of us cycle on a regular basis, other would but say there are no facilities to do so. Classic chicken egg issue !

City Office:

Cycle racks for 40 bikes
In a covered bike cage
CCTV
5 x unisex showers
Fluffy white towels
Lockers
shoe racks
Very basic drying facilities (but ask IT nicely and they put stuff in the server room)
Suit/Shirt service (£2 per shirt washed, ironed, hung and delivered)
£1 cyclists breakfast (porrage, banana, tost, cereals etc)

Ours is called TWUG (two wheel user group) because BUG (building user group) was already taken... but this has the added advantage of incorporating motorcycle users.

we have lockers, showers, bike racks, drying room. and we are just setting up a TWUG site on the company infonet for safety info etc.
